<DIV> <DIV><STRONG>Q.  I just harvested a rare, what spell should I upgrade?</STRONG></DIV> <DIV><STRONG></STRONG> </DIV> <DIV>Courtesy of Elewood's FAQ here : <A href="http://eqiiforums.station.sony.com/eq2/board/message?board.id=30&message.id=3829" target=_blank>http://eqiiforums.station.sony.com/eq2/board/message?board.id=30&message.id=3829</A></DIV> <DIV> </DIV> <DIV> </DIV> <DIV>A.  Another one that's a little subjective but I'll answer what I would do.  All spells should be upgraded as high as possible, preferably to adept 1... these spells are the over and above's; the ones that should be adept 3.  There are two lists of spells to upgrade, just getting to a spell or if you're upgrading older spells and I'll note if there should be another spell in consideration after each tier listing.  If I offer advice that goes against what you'll normally hear, my reasons will be included:</DIV> <DIV> </DIV> <DIV>T2 (Level 10 to 19)</DIV> <DIV>1.  Soothe Servant (our only direct pet heal, doesn't share a timer with the necro heals so important all the way to lvl50)</DIV> <DIV>2.  Agitation (the proc stacks with all necro buffs, the only problem with it is at the higher levels the proc can't hit raid mobs)</DIV> <DIV>3.  Essence shift (stacks with all other pet taps, you'll stop using it around 50 but helps all the way 'til that level)</DIV> <DIV>Special notes:  If you are just getting to 13 and harvest a rare, dust blast goes to the number one spot in upgrade order.  If you're in the 20's stick to the listed order.  The recommended are used all the way to 50 so can be upgraded any time.</DIV> <DIV> </DIV> <DIV>T3 (Level 20 to 29)</DIV> <DIV>1.  Undying adherant (tank pet, most important spell upgrade every time)</DIV> <DIV>2.  Pestilential blast</DIV> <DIV>3.  Swarm of rats</DIV> <DIV>4.  Boon of the lifeless</DIV> <DIV>Special notes:  If you aren't fairly near (levelwise) when you receive these upgrades, don't bother.</DIV> <DIV> </DIV> <DIV>T4 (Level 30 to 39)  Tricky level range since you've got carryover into the current final tier.</DIV> <DIV>1.  Rotting Thrall (single most important spell we have)</DIV> <DIV>2.  Plague of Rats (huge damage spell, well worth the rare)</DIV> <DIV>3.  Words of the wicked (great pet buff, worth the upgrade)</DIV> <DIV>4.  Ghastly stench</DIV> <DIV>Special notes:  Many would recommend swarm of bats, I do not.  The upgrade from apprentice 4 to adept 3 is about 6% damage increase, on that spell the increase translates to about 25 more damage every 24 seconds, not worth the rare.</DIV> <DIV> </DIV> <DIV>T5 (Level 40-50)  Lots of special considerations in this tier, the initial list is upgrading when 50</DIV> <DIV>1.  Siphon life (our only truely stackable necro spell)</DIV> <DIV>2.  Lich (it's a pretty good power spell, not great but worth the upgrade)</DIV> <DIV>3.  Skinrot (a good nuke, be sure if you have another level 50 in your guild that you upgrade at the same time otherwise you two won't stack at all)</DIV> <DIV>4.  Rending Frenzy (pet buff, always worth upgrading)</DIV> <DIV>5.  Necrotic mending (last pet heal)</DIV> <DIV>6.  Stench of the grave</DIV> <DIV>7.  Death's coil</DIV> <DIV>Special notes:  If you're just coming up on either 1 or 3, upgrade the one you're closest to.  If you just hit 45 and got a rare, get siphon, if you just hit 43, get skinrot.</DIV> <DIV> </DIV> <DIV>Hope that helps,</DIV> <DIV> </DIV> <DIV>Eirgorn</DIV></DIV>
